May 25, 2006 [POETRY SLAM] Maui Booksellers' spoken word "poetry slam" is back! After outgrowing its original home in the cozy Wailuku bookstore, the competition moves to the historic Iao Theater for the first time. That's right, folks—competition! Randy Mills, who won the last poetry slam in April, says that while it's less personal than 8 Mile-style rap battles, the competitions can be intense (perhaps due to the $100 cash prize). Admission is $10 (only $7 in advance or $5 with student/seniors I.D.), which is slightly more than a ticket to Tom Cruise's latest clunker, only I guarantee this will be much more thought provoking and inspiring. And I imagine you'll have a far better chance of not being distracted by high-schoolers' cell phone conversations. Come watch Mills attempt to defend his title against Maui's best spoken-wordsmiths, or come early and sign up (7 p.m.) to perform yourself. Either way, make it a point to show up and observe some true artistic expression. For more info, call Maui Booksellers at 244-9091. [COREY "THE INTERN" NIELSEN]
